深入解析Shadowsocks(SS)VPN技术原理与安全应用实践

hyde1011 15 2026-03-10 02:46:43

在当今全球网络环境日益复杂、信息流动受限频繁的背景下,越来越多用户开始关注如何通过合法合规的方式实现稳定、安全的互联网访问,Shadowsocks(简称SS)作为一种开源的代理软件,因其轻量高效、抗干扰能力强而受到广泛欢迎,作为网络工程师,我将从技术原理、部署方式、安全性分析及最佳实践四个方面,系统性地讲解Shadowsocks的运作机制及其在实际场景中的合理使用。

Shadowsocks的核心思想是“加密传输 + 代理转发”,它并不直接提供虚拟私有网络(VPN)服务,而是通过在客户端和服务器之间建立一个加密通道,将用户的原始流量伪装成普通HTTPS或HTTP请求进行转发,其工作流程如下:用户本地运行SS客户端,配置远程服务器地址、端口和密码;客户端对原始数据包加密后发送至服务器;服务器解密后,再将请求转发到目标网站,最终将响应返回给用户,整个过程对第三方而言,仅能看到加密流量,无法识别真实内容,从而有效规避审查或监控。

在部署方面,Shadowsocks支持多种协议,如SSR(ShadowsocksR)、v2ray、Trojan等变种,主流版本包括传统的Shadowsocks-libev(Linux平台)和基于Python开发的shadowsocks-python,对于个人用户,推荐使用一键脚本(如宝塔面板插件或GitHub开源项目)快速搭建服务端;企业级部署则需考虑负载均衡、日志审计、自动更新等功能,建议结合Nginx反向代理和Let’s Encrypt证书提升安全性与可用性。

安全性是SS用户最关心的问题,虽然SS本身采用AES-256等强加密算法,但若配置不当仍存在风险,使用弱密码、未启用混淆(obfuscation)功能、暴露公网IP且无防火墙保护,均可能导致被探测或攻击,建议启用“Simple Obfs”或“TLS+Obfs”混淆模式,使流量更接近正常网页访问特征;定期更换密码、限制IP白名单、启用Fail2ban防暴力破解,可显著增强防护能力。

在法律层面,应强调:Shadowsocks并非用于非法目的的技术工具,其本质是解决网络访问受限问题的中立手段,在中国大陆地区,使用SS等代理工具需遵守《网络安全法》及相关法规,不得用于传播违法不良信息,我们鼓励用户理性使用,优先选择合法渠道获取境外资源,并关注国家政策动态。

Shadowsocks是一项值得深入了解的网络技术,掌握其原理与应用,不仅能提升网络自主性,也能帮助我们更好地理解现代互联网通信的本质,作为网络工程师,我们应在保障安全的前提下,推动技术向善发展。

深入解析Shadowsocks(SS)VPN技术原理与安全应用实践

上一篇:工信部严控VPN服务,网络安全与合规发展的双刃剑
下一篇:校园VPN部署与优化,提升教学与科研网络体验的关键策略
相关文章
返回顶部小火箭